Music with Toy Instruments.
(The Toy Instruments may be had of the Publishers)
Gurlitt, C. Kindersymphonie. Toy-Symphony for Piano­forte (Violin and Violoncello ad lib.), Cuckoo, Quail, Night­ingale, Trumpet, Triangle, and Drum. Op. 169. (7108). II.
Haydn, J. Toy Symphony for Pianoforte i^or 2 Violins and Bass) and 7 Toy Instruments. Score and Parts. (7109). II.
Reinecke, C. Kinder-Symphonie. Toy-Symphony for Piano­forte, 2 Violins, Violoncello, and 9 Toy-instruments (Night­ingale, Cuckoo, 2 Trumpets, Drum, Rattle, Bells, Glass-bell, and Tea-tray). Score and parts. (7115). II.
Romberg, B. Toy Symphony (Kinder-Sinfonie) for Piano (or 2 Violins and Bass) with 7 Toy Instruments. (7116). II.
